NME3 mRNA is preferentially expressed at early stages of myeloid differentiation of highly purified CD34(+) cells. Its constitutive expression in a myeloid precursor line, which is growth-factor dependent for both proliferation and differentiation, results in inhibition of granulocytic differentiation induced by granulocyte colony-stimulating factor and causes apoptotic cell death. These results appear consistent with a role for the NME3 gene in normal hematopoiesis and raise the possibility that its overexpression contributes to differentiation arrest, a feature of blastic transformation in chronic myelogenous leukemia.

Uniprot Description
NME3: Major role in the synthesis of nucleoside triphosphates other than ATP. The ATP gamma phosphate is transferred to the NDP beta phosphate via a ping-pong mechanism, using a phosphorylated active-site intermediate. Probably has a role in normal hematopoiesis by inhibition of granulocyte differentiation and induction of apoptosis. Belongs to the NDK family.
Protein type: Kinase, other; Kinase, nucleoside diphosphate; Nucleotide Metabolism - pyrimidine; EC 2.7.4.6; Apoptosis; Motility/polarity/chemotaxis; Nucleotide Metabolism - purine; Other group; NDK family
Chromosomal Location of Human Ortholog: 16q13.3
Cellular Component: mitochondrion; cytosol
Molecular Function: metal ion binding; nucleoside diphosphate kinase activity; ATP binding
Biological Process: GTP biosynthetic process; regulation of apoptosis; CTP biosynthetic process; apoptosis; pyrimidine nucleotide metabolic process; UTP biosynthetic process; nucleoside triphosphate biosynthetic process; nucleoside diphosphate phosphorylation; purine nucleotide metabolic process
